1 Star 1 Fork 0

aaaac/AWD_CTF_Platform

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
bin_pwn
check_server
flag_server
img
web_chinaz
web_example1
web_example2
web_gotsctf2018
web_javatsctf2018
web_simplecms
writes_up
.gitignore
LICENSE
flag.py
host.list
pass.txt
pre.py
readme.md
start.py
stop_clean.py
克隆/下载
start.py 775 Bytes
一键复制 编辑 原始数据 按行查看 历史
moxiaoxi 提交于 6年前 . 增加致谢
#!/usr/bin/env python
import sys
import os
teamno = int(sys.argv[1])
def start_flag():
os.system('cd flag_server && sh docker.sh')
print('[*] start docker flag_server')
def gen_host_lists():
res = ''
for i in range(teamno):
res += "team%d:172.17.0.%d\n" % (i + 1, i + 2)
open('check_server/host.lists', 'w').write(res)
def start_check():
gen_host_lists()
os.system('cd check_server && sh docker.sh')
print('[*] start docker check_server')
def start_team(teamno):
team_dir = 'team' + str(teamno).zfill(2)
os.system('cd %s && sh docker.sh' % (team_dir))
print('[*] start docker %s' % team_dir)
if __name__ == '__main__':
for i in range(1, teamno + 1):
start_team(i)
start_flag()
start_check()
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/mucn/AWD_CTF_Platform.git
git@gitee.com:mucn/AWD_CTF_Platform.git
mucn
AWD_CTF_Platform
AWD_CTF_Platform
master

搜索帮助